Determining the Order of Questions
Opening questionsShould be interesting, easy and non-threatening
2
— they determine whether respondents continue.
Type of informationRule of thumb: ask the research-relevant information first, then the classification and lastly the identification information
3
.
Difficult questionsPlace sensitive, embarrassing, complicated or tedious questions as far back
 as possible.
